#16There is no such thing as a "STEM job". There are computer science jobs and marine biology jobs, both under the rubric of STEM, but the skill sets are not fungible and the employment prospects are wildly different. We can simultaneously produce more STEM graduates than jobs and have a shortage of workers for STEM jobs.
